Transaction 64e9538c84ae5766493779921c2d17802ac5a1a10db8cda1628064b15767abb6
1 Input
1 Output
-
64e9538c84ae5766493779921c2d17802ac5a1a10db8cda1628064b15767abb6:0
- value
- 42427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2eb8ee708cb948eeac6639daf82f988086efba9f OP_EQUAL
- address
- 35x4YdLF2khUiuuNdmkPYao8S1ZzyYTDcA